The Field Marketing Executive is essential in driving lead generation and supporting the local sales team through community outreach, grassroots marketing, and event planning. This role focuses on building relationships and implementing strategies that promote sales growth, enhance branding, and increase community presence, all contributing to our market expansion objectives.
Working closely with agents and their leaders, you will create plans that drive new enrollments, improve retention for existing members, and forge meaningful connections with local organizations and influencers. This position allows for significant influence on departmental strategy and requires decision-making on complex project components.
Key Responsibilities
- Liaison Role: Serve as the liaison between sales, markets, and community partners for effective coordination and execution.
- Team Culture: Cultivate a collaborative team environment focused on mission-driven growth and accountability.
- Outreach Strategies: Design and implement local outreach initiatives, including events and partnerships, to generate quality leads.
- Lead Cultivation: Identify and nurture high-potential lead sources, including those transitioning into Medicare (T65 opportunities).
- Performance Monitoring: Assess and report on the success of grassroots marketing, community outreach, and events.
- Community Engagement: Develop and sustain strong relationships with community organizations, local businesses, and other key stakeholders.
- Event Execution: Oversee planning and execution of community events to boost brand visibility and lead generation.
- Reporting: Regularly prepare and present reports on outreach efforts, performance, and results.
